Mateschitz: Red Bull's F1 future still not guaranteed

Red Bull boss Dietrich Mateschitz says that another Adrian Newey "masterpiece" may not be enough to keep his team in Formula 1 over the longer term. After the political dramas surrounding his F1 outfits last year, an extension of its partnership with Renault – albeit run as rebranded TAG Heuer power units – has kept his team in grand prix racing. But in an interview with the Red Bull-owned Speedweek website, Mateschitz has said that longer term, his outfit must ensure it gets a more competitive engine. “We are too good to be domestiques,” he said, referring to bike riders who support their team-mates. “Formula 1 is not the Tour de France. “If we are not competitive...
